先附上源代码:│ admin.py                         管理员界面 │ alluser.txt  &n
简易银行系统简介 本博文将通过简易的Python与数据库间联动,实现简易的银行系统。该系统主要功能有用户注册,用户登录,余额查询,存取款以及转账。代码实现:1、数据库的建立进入MySQL环境 mysql -h MySQL服务器地址 -u 用户名 -p显示所有数据库 show databases; 3.创建数据库 create database 数据库名称 [default character se
from helper importHelperfrom card importCardfrom user importUserimporttimeclassOperate:def __init__(self, userinfo): self.userinfo=userinfo#开户 defnew_user(self): name= input('请输入您的姓名:') uid= input('请输
项目介绍随着信息技术和网络技术的飞速发展,人类已进入全新信息化时代,传统管理技术已无法高效,便捷地管理信息。为了迎合时代需求,优化管理效率,各种各样的管理系统应运而生,各行各业相继进入信息管理时代,银行取号用户管理系统就是信息时代变革中的产物之一。 任何系统都要遵循系统设计的基本流程,本系统也不例外,同样需要经过市场调研,需求分析,概要设计,详细设计,编码,测试这些步骤,基于python语言、Dj
银行家算法的python实现前言一、什么是银行家算法(Banker's Algorithm)二、代码实现1.requirements2.定义变量3.检查本次分配是否安全4.分配函数5.完整代码三、我的仓库 前言写操作系统作业的时候,发现代码题没有要求语言,就试着用python写了。《现代操作系统》第四版,第六章死锁的课后题41题: 41.Program a simulation of the b
目录~python面向对象编程之模拟银行系统相关程序代码如下:运行效果如下:pandas 每日一练:运行结果为:66、绘制sku_cost_prc的密度曲线运行效果为:67、计算后一天与前一天sku_cost_prc的差值运行结果为:68、计算后一天与前一天sku_cost_prc变化率运行结果为:69、设置日期为索引运行结果为:70、以9个数据作为一个数据滑动窗口,在这5个数据上取均值(`sk
转载 2023-06-16 19:59:09
190阅读
功能: 开户、查询、取款、存款、转账、改密、锁定、解锁、补卡、销户、退出简述:用户需要用身份证号码开户注册一个银行卡号,可以实现查询、存款取款等功能。此系统主要采用面向对象的方法,信息存储方式采用json模块来进行存储。(数据存储也可以用pickle模块,彩票系统已采用,此系统就不用pickle模块,而采用json模块,下文会简单介绍一下json和pickle的优缺点,纯属个人见解)系统
转载 2023-06-07 11:18:29
500阅读
银行代码源码解析管理员类Admin()Admin代码ATM()类ATM代码人类person()类person代码银行卡类card()card代码main()主函数银行自动提款代码主函数main()代码银行提款机演示 目录上面先需要分析,有那些类,类有什么属性人 类名:Person 属性:姓名,身份证号,电话号,卡 行为: 卡 类名:Card 属性:卡号,密码,余额 行为: 提款机 类名:
需求:实现开户、查询、存款、取款、转账、改密、锁卡、解卡、销户、退出这十个功能首先,创建一个账户类account.py# 账户类 class Account: def __init__(self,name,aid,card): self.name = name self.aid = aid self.card = card def
    目前的银行柜面业务处理系统,基本都是b/s或c/s架构的,柜面系统通过网络与前置系统或者核心系统相互通讯。由于网络的不可靠性,常常出现传输过程中交易数据的丢失,造成客户端与服务端的交易不完整或数据不一致,这样会对银行造成相应的现成风险和潜在风险。如何控制数据的一致性,是目前银行系统联机事务交易处理所必须考虑的问题。一、 导致数据不一致的原因    在
今天看到一个比较好玩的需求,模拟实现银行业务调度系统逻辑,需求如下:银行业务调度系统 模拟实现银行业务调度系统逻辑,具体需求如下:  银行内有6个业务窗口,1 - 4号窗口为普通窗口,5号窗口为快速窗口,6号窗口为VIP窗口。  有三种对应类型的客户:VIP客户,普通客户,快速客户(办理如交水电费、电话费之类业务的客户)。  异步随机生成各种类型的客户,生成各类型用
转载 2023-12-12 15:19:19
86阅读
目录大二的时候python有个课堂作业是银行管理系统,不太满意当时的功能,于是添加了点功能。后来大三了,对python的认知又更进了一步就再次改良了我的代码。程序入口(首页)文件名: home.py实现开户功能(随机生成六位数的卡号、储存卡号密码、验证密码,记录开户动作): kaihu.py 取款(输入卡号密码进行取款操作,验证余额,校对密码,记录取款动作):qu.py存款(输入卡号密码
# auther zjs # data 2019/7/19 15:44 # file_name BAM # 银行账户管理系统(BAM) # 写一个账户类(Account): # 属性: id:账户号码 长整数 # password:账户密码 # name:真实姓名 # person_id:身份证号码 字符串类型 # email:客户的电子邮箱 # balance:账户余额 # 方法: # dep
1、概述 使用面向对象思想模拟一个简单的银行系统,具备的功能:管理员登录/注销、用户开户、登录、找回密码、挂失、改密、查询、存取款、转账等功能。 编程语言:python。2、目的 通过这个编程练习,可以熟悉运用面向对象的思想来解决实际问题,其中用到的知识点有类的封装、正则表达式、模块等。3、体会 在编写这个程序时,实际上的业务逻辑还是要考虑的,比如修改密码时需要输入手机号、身份证号等。在进行类的封
   目       录一、系统说明二、用户信息三、取款系统一、系统说明请你编写一个银行取款系统程序,要求具备以下几点功能。1.开户业务 一个证件号码只可以绑定一个账号,系统首先验证用户证件号码, 如证件已在系统存在则不提供开户业务。2.登陆系统 用户通过账号和密码登录系统,验证通过进入系统进行操作。3.存款业务 用户登陆系统后,选择存款
Python两种银行系统对比简介静态银行系统(一)设置访问页面和菜单页面管理员登录验证开户功能查询功能取款功能存款功能转账功能改密功能冻结功能解冻功能补卡功能销户功能开户功能卡号生成方式主程序启动静态银行系统(二)管理员登录页面开户功能查询功能存款功能转账功能退出功能主程序后记 简介两种都是静态银行系统,采用的知识都差不多,接下来大家来看看那种写的好。静态银行系统(一)此银行系统有11种功能,分
import time import random import pickle import os class Card(object): def __init__(self, cardId, cardPasswd, cardMoney): self.cardId = cardId self.cardPasswd = cardPasswd
转载 2023-08-21 21:57:41
85阅读
使用python面向对象写银行系统银行卡类:卡号、金额、密码、状态用户类:名字、身份证、银行卡管理员类:账号、密码、登录页面、菜单界面、欢迎信息操作类:开户、存款、查询、取款、转账、锁定、解锁、改密、退出新建一个项目,建议使用pycharm。1,新建card.py 文件,写银行卡类# 银行卡类 class Card: def __init__(self, cid, pwd):
#include<stdio.h> #include<stdlib.h>int cunkuan(int);//存款函数 void chaxun(int);//查询函数 int qukuan(int);//取款函数 void password();//修改密码函数//变量说明 mima初始密码 pass用户输入密码 newpass修改后密码 qrpass确认密码 ckmon
转载 2023-12-15 13:58:57
374阅读
      相信你也有我类似的经历,去银行办事,人特别多,如果有电子排队系统,那就可以坐着等,理论上应该很好才对,但其实仔细想想,还是有很多问题存在的。       电子排队系统大致是这样的,即来的客户先在门口的电子触摸屏上按一下获得一个排队号,然后等待叫号。银行工作人员(比如三个)每个人处理完一笔
转载 2023-11-14 14:13:57
89阅读
  • 1
  • 2
  • 3
  • 4
  • 5